This page summarises the information held within TEPCat for the transiting planetary system Kepler-446b. Please see here for descriptions of the quantities given below.
| Quantity | Value | Unit |
|---|---|---|
| Reference of discovery paper | 2015ApJ...801...18M | |
| Date of discovery paper | 2015 / 1 / 8 | y / m / d |
| Data/telescope used for discovery | Kepler | |
| Right ascension | 18 49 00.05 | h m s |
| Declination | +44 55 16.0 | d m s |
| Right ascension (decimal) | 282.25021 | degrees |
| Declination (decimal) | 44.92111 | degrees |
| V-band apparent magnitude | 17.26 | mag |
| K-band apparent magnitude | 12.83 | mag |
| Transit duration | 0.0325 ( 0.780 ) | day hour |
| Transit depth | 0.33 | % |
| Time of mid-transit | 2454965.9135 ± 0.0019 | HJD or BJD |
| Orbital period | 1.565409 ± 0.0000033 | days |
| Reference for orbital ephemeris | 2015ApJ...801...18M |
| Quantity | Value | Unit |
|---|---|---|
| Stellar effective temperature | 3359 ± 60 | K |
| Stellar metal abundance ([Fe/H] or [M/H]) | −0.30 ± 0.12 | dex |
| Stellar mass | 0.22 ± 0.05 | Msun |
| Stellar radius | 0.24 ± 0.04 | Rsun |

| Orbital eccentricity | 0.0 | |

| Planetary radius | 0.134 ± 0.022 ( 1.50 ± 0.25 ) | Rjup Rearth |
